Demographics Historical populationĪs of the census of 2010, there were 5,915 people, 2,172 households, and 1,492 families residing in the borough. The borough is the older and more urban core area located in the center of and completely surrounded by Monroe Township, making it part of 21 pairs of "doughnut towns" in the state, where one municipality entirely surrounds another.
